About This Item

Gateshead: Northumberland Press for the Surtees Society, 1977. First Edition. Hardcover. Very Good. Gateshead, Northumberland Press for the Surtees Society, 1977 [first edition]. Octavo; blind-stamped cloth; an excellent copy. Presentation copy, warmly inscribed to Dr Heinz Kent (see p 173) and signed by the author.

About Michael Treloar Antiquarian Booksellers

The business was established in Adelaide in March 1976 and is a longstanding member of the Australian and New Zealand Association of Antiquarian Booksellers (ANZAAB) and the Australian Antique Dealers Association (AADA). A large out-of-print and antiquarian stock is maintained at our retail outlet in the centre of Adelaide; mail-order catalogues of our specializations are issued and a representative selection of our stock is online.
